I breed both dual-purpose chickens and egg-laying chickens,\u201d she says.<\/p>\n<p>Shatilwe also sells chicks, which she hatches with machinery she has procured herself.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When I saw my chickens were becoming a lot, I started loving them and decided to start breeding them. I grew up to 1 000 chickens every month,\u201d she says.<\/p>\n<p>She says she ordered her broiler chickens from South Africa.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cIt was not easy at first, because I have been struggling due to a lack of poultry farming experience. I started attending workshops, and I got a mentor in the region \u2013 Tauno Shikomba,\u201d she says.<\/p>\n<p>Shatilwe says people in the region started buying her chickens, upon which she decided to expand her farm and to start selling eggs as well.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I have created WhatsApp groups on which I post my chickens, chicks and eggs. I have a lot of buyers, and currently I sell to people for events like school bazaars and weddings,\u201d she says.<\/p>\n<p>She says chicken feed is becoming expensive.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I have realised those feeds are not sufficient, and now I mix them with sunflower seeds I grow myself, melon seeds, maize seeds, pearl millet and sorghum seeds. I give my chickens these feeds when they&#8217;re six weeks old,\u201d she says.<\/p>\n<p>Shatilwe says pearl millet seems to slow chikens&#8217; growth.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I tried looking for assistance from the government, but was rejected due to my age. But that didn&#8217;t make me give up. The feeds are expensive, and I decided to produce my own too,\u201d she says.<\/p>\n<p>The farmer says she is assisted by family and community members, and recruits students from her village.<\/p>\n<p>She says she pays them in cash, live chickens, chicks, or eggs.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I now also mentor people who want to start poultry farming. I have trained 10 women from my community, and many of them are cruising nicely. Only a few have dumped the idea,\u201d she says.<\/p>\n<p>Shatilwe says her biggest challenge was a lack of knowledge, high input costs, chicken medicine, and theft.<\/p>\n<p>Last year, she says 68 chickens were stolen from her, which has affected her business.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cCovid-19 has also hindered my business as there were no customers,\u201d she says.<\/p>\n<p>Shatilwe says to protect her chickens, she ensures the chicken house is clean and provides her chickens a balanced diet.<\/p>\n<p>She says she also vaccinates her chickens, gives them vitamins and supplements, and lots of clean water.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cEver since I started, I have not received a complaint from my clients. One thing I like is biosecurity. People who visit chickens bring them diseases, and that&#8217;s why I avoid them entering the chicken house,\u201d she says.<\/p>\n<p>Shatilwe encourages young people to start small projects in their areas and apply for support from the government.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e government does not help those who are quiet, but those who are trying. Start with something small.
